Добавить ярлыки сайтов в контекстное меню Windows
Важно: редактирование реестра может повлиять на систему. Перед изменениями создайте резервную копию реестра или точку восстановления Windows.
Контекстное меню — это небольшое меню, которое появляется в Windows при нажатии правой кнопкой мыши. Несмотря на то что Windows не предлагает встроенный способ добавления ярлыков сайтов в контекстное меню рабочего стола, вы можете сделать это вручную, отредактировав реестр. Такой ярлык открывает сайт непосредственно в выбранном браузере и не загромождает рабочий стол.
Как добавить ярлыки сайтов через реестр — пошаговая инструкция
Ниже приведён подробный набор шагов для Windows 11 и Windows 10. Инструкция даёт понятную процедуру: создаём ключ в разделe Shell для фоновой области рабочего стола и указываем команду запуска браузера с адресом.
Нажмите правой кнопкой мыши по значку меню «Пуск» на панели задач и выберите Запустить (Run), чтобы открыть диалог.
Введите
regeditв поле Открыть и нажмите OK, чтобы запустить редактор реестра.В адресной строке редактора реестра перейдите по пути:
Computer\HKEY_CLASSES_ROOT\Directory\Background\shellЩёлкните правой кнопкой по ключу
shellв левой панели и выберите New → Key (Создать → Ключ).
Введите имя нового ключа — например
Bing(это будет текст пункта меню).Щёлкните правой кнопкой по созданному ключу
Bing, выберите New → Key и создайте подпапку с именемcommand.Выделите ключ
commandи дважды щёлкните по значению(Default)в правой панели.В поле «Значение» (Value data) введите команду запуска браузера, например:
C:\Program Files (x86)\Microsoft\Edge\Application\msedge.exe bing.comЭтот пример использует полный путь к исполняемому файлу Microsoft Edge и домен сайта.
- Нажмите OK, чтобы сохранить значение.
- Закройте редактор реестра.
Никакой перезагрузки Windows обычно не требуется. На Windows 11 щёлкните правой кнопкой по рабочему столу и выберите Показать дополнительные параметры (Show more options), чтобы увидеть классическое контекстное меню с новым пунктом.
Примеры команд для разных браузеров
Microsoft Edge (обычный путь по умолчанию):
C:\Program Files (x86)\Microsoft\Edge\Application\msedge.exe bing.comGoogle Chrome (полный путь к EXE + домен):
"C:\Полный\Путь\к\chrome.exe" bing.comПримечание: если путь содержит пробелы, возьмите путь в кавычки.
Opera:
"C:\Путь\к\opera.exe" bing.comFirefox (можно указывать просто команду
firefox):firefox bing.com
URL не обязан начинаться с https:// или www. — достаточно доменного имени. Для безопасной работы рекомендую указывать полные пути к исполняемым файлам браузеров, чтобы исключить зависимость от переменной PATH.
Чтобы узнать полный путь к браузеру, щёлкните правой кнопкой по ярлыку браузера на рабочем столе → Свойства → Вкладка Ярлык → поле «Объект» (Target), скопируйте путь и вставьте его в значение реестра.
Для Firefox достаточно указать firefox и домен, поскольку Firefox обычно зарегистрирован в PATH при установке.
Как удалить добавленные пункты меню
- Откройте редактор реестра и перейдите в
Computer\HKEY_CLASSES_ROOT\Directory\Background\shell. - Найдите ключ с именем пункта меню (например
Bing). - Щёлкните по нему правой кнопкой и выберите Удалить (Delete).
- Подтвердите удаление кнопкой Да (Yes).
Когда этот способ не сработает и возможные ошибки
- Если путь к исполняемому файлу указан неверно, пункт появится, но при клике сайт не откроется. Проверьте точность пути и кавычки.
- Для портативных сборок браузеров без регистрации в системе рекомендуется указывать абсолютный путь к EXE.
- В средах с ограниченными правами (учётные записи без прав администратора или политики домена) запись в реестр может быть заблокирована.
- Антивирус/защитник Windows может мешать выполнению EXE из нестандартных путей. В таком случае используйте стандартные пути или настройте исключение.
Альтернативы (если не хотите редактировать реестр)
- Сторонние утилиты-менеджеры контекстного меню: приложения с графическим интерфейсом для добавления/удаления пунктов контекстного меню.
- Ярлыки сайтов на рабочем столе: удобнее для визуального доступа, но они занимают место.
- Расширения/панели браузера: закрепите часто используемые сайты в панели избранного.
Мини‑методология: безопасный рабочий процесс
- Создайте точку восстановления системы или экспортируйте ветку реестра
shellперед изменениями. - Делайте изменения по одному пункту и проверяйте результат.
- Документируйте точные команды и пути для будущей поддержки.
Чек‑лист для ролей
Для администратора:
- Создать точку восстановления.
- Прописать политики безопасности (если требуется массовое развёртывание).
- Проверить совместимость всех целевых рабочих станций.
Для рядового пользователя:
- Скопировать точный путь из свойств ярлыка браузера.
- Ввести команду в реестре аккуратно; не изменять другие ключи.
Для техподдержки:
- Проверить права доступа и журналы событий, если пункт не работает.
- Восстановить экспортированный ключ реестра при необходимости.
Критерии приёмки
- Пункт контекстного меню появился в классическом меню (Show more options → имя пункта).
- При клике по пункту сайт открывается в указанном браузере.
- Новые пункты не нарушают работу других пунктов контекстного меню.
Тестовые случаи
- Создать пункт для
example.comс путём к Chrome. Ожидаемый результат: Chrome открываетexample.com. - Указать неверный путь к EXE. Ожидаемый результат: пункт есть, при клике — ошибка или ничто не происходит; в логах — не найден файл.
- Удалить ключ и проверить, что пункт исчез из меню.
Безопасность и конфиденциальность
- Убедитесь, что указываете путь только на доверенные исполняемые файлы.
- Не вставляйте сторонние параметры в командную строку, которые могут выполнять произвольные скрипты.
- Для рабочих машин с чувствительными данными обсудите изменение реестра с отделом информационной безопасности.
Быстрые рекомендации и подсказки
- Используйте кавычки вокруг путей, содержащих пробелы.
- Для массового развёртывания можно подготовить .reg файл с нужными ключами и распространить его через групповые политики.
Часто задаваемые вопросы
Нужно ли перезагружать компьютер после изменений?
Обычно перезагрузка не требуется. Достаточно щёлкнуть правой кнопкой по рабочему столу и открыть контекстное меню. В редких случаях Explorer может потребовать перезапуска.
Можно ли создать подменю со списком сайтов?
Да. Вместо обычного пункта создайте ключ с подпунктами: внутри ключа создайте несколько ключей с именами сайтов и для каждого создайте command с нужной строкой запуска.
Я добавил пункт, но он не виден — что проверить?
Проверьте правильность расположения ключа: путь должен быть Computer\\HKEY_CLASSES_ROOT\\Directory\\Background\\shell. Убедитесь, что значение (Default) содержит корректную команду.
Итого: добавление ярлыков сайтов в контекстное меню рабочего стола — простой и гибкий способ быстро открывать любимые сайты без загромождения рабочего стола. Если требуется централизованное управление, используйте .reg‑файлы или групповые политики для развёртывания.